The Federal Reserve made history by leaving interest rates steady at its July 29 meeting, a move that has significant implications for the stock market.

Fed Chair Kevin Warsh inherited a divided central bank, with a historic level of dissension so early in his tenure. The FOMC meeting was notable not only because of the lack of rate hike but also due to the three dissenting votes from Beth Hammack, Neel Kashkari, and Lorie Logan, who favored a quarter-point rate hike.

This division among FOMC policymakers is potentially dangerous for Wall Street, as it suggests an increased likelihood of the Federal Reserve raising interest rates to stabilize prices. If interest rates climb, it could slow the artificial intelligence (AI) infrastructure build-out that's been foundational to the Dow's, S&P 500's, and Nasdaq Composite's rallies.
